When is app development the wrong thing to buy?

When is app development the wrong thing to buy?

Not every business that asks for this should buy it, and saying so has kept clients with us longer than selling would have.

If the same thing works as a mobile website, build that instead and spend the difference on reaching people.

If there is no budget for the year after launch, the app will be broken by the next OS release.

If a fast mobile website does the same job, build that and spend the difference on reaching people.

If there is no budget for the year after launch, the next operating system release will break it.

If any of that describes you, we will say so on the first call and point you at what to do instead.

How much does app development cost in Lubbock, Texas?

Pricing depends on scope, and the honest version is that the following factors decide it.

Whatever the number is, it is agreed in writing first, and anything outside it is quoted separately before it is started.

For real estate businesses in Lubbock the useful question is not the monthly fee but what the listing appointment is worth. We ask that first, because it sets the ceiling on what any channel is allowed to cost.

  • Whether both platforms are needed at launch or one can wait
  • Authentication, payments, and compliance requirements
  • Offline behavior, which is deceptively expensive to do properly
  • Backend and integration complexity, usually the largest hidden cost

How is App Development success measured and reported?

The measures below are the ones we hold ourselves to. Impressions and follower counts are not among them.

Shipping a narrow first version teaches you what to build next far more cheaply than planning it does.

For real estate businesses in Lubbock we report the listing appointment specifically, not sessions. A month with less traffic and more of those is a good month and the report should say so plainly.

You will get the bad months as clearly as the good ones, because a report you cannot trust is worth nothing.

  • Task completion time compared with the process it replaced
  • Day seven and day thirty retention, which predict everything else
  • Cost per install against the lifetime value of an installed user
  • Crash-free session rate
